.controls-card.svelte-11uqiyn,.chart-card.svelte-11uqiyn,.explain-card.svelte-11uqiyn{border-radius:var(--radius-xl);border:1px solid var(--color-border);background:var(--color-surface);margin-bottom:1rem;padding:1rem 1.1rem}.field-grid.svelte-11uqiyn{grid-template-columns:repeat(4,minmax(0,1fr));gap:.75rem;display:grid}@media (width<=1024px){.field-grid.svelte-11uqiyn{grid-template-columns:repeat(2,minmax(0,1fr))}}@media (width<=640px){.field-grid.svelte-11uqiyn{grid-template-columns:1fr}}.field.svelte-11uqiyn label:where(.svelte-11uqiyn),.controls-card.svelte-11uqiyn h2:where(.svelte-11uqiyn),.chart-card.svelte-11uqiyn h2:where(.svelte-11uqiyn),.explain-card.svelte-11uqiyn h2:where(.svelte-11uqiyn){color:var(--color-muted);text-transform:uppercase;letter-spacing:.04em;margin-bottom:.5rem;font-size:.82rem;font-weight:600}.field.svelte-11uqiyn input:where(.svelte-11uqiyn),.field.svelte-11uqiyn select:where(.svelte-11uqiyn){border-radius:var(--radius-md);border:1px solid var(--color-border);background:var(--color-surface-2);color:var(--color-text);padding:.65rem .8rem}.option-row.svelte-11uqiyn{grid-template-columns:repeat(auto-fit,minmax(140px,1fr));gap:.6rem;margin-bottom:1rem;display:grid}@media (width<=640px){.option-row.svelte-11uqiyn{grid-template-columns:repeat(auto-fit,minmax(100px,1fr))}}.option-row.svelte-11uqiyn button:where(.svelte-11uqiyn){border-radius:var(--radius-lg);border:1px solid var(--color-border);background:var(--color-surface-2);color:var(--color-text);text-align:left;padding:.75rem .85rem}.option-row.svelte-11uqiyn button.active:where(.svelte-11uqiyn){border-color:color-mix(in srgb, var(--color-secondary) 45%, transparent);background:color-mix(in srgb, var(--color-secondary) 8%, transparent)}.option-row.svelte-11uqiyn small:where(.svelte-11uqiyn){color:var(--color-muted);margin-top:.3rem;display:block}.try-example-wrapper.svelte-11uqiyn{margin-bottom:1rem}.actions-bar.svelte-11uqiyn{flex-wrap:wrap;gap:.75rem;display:flex}.results-grid.svelte-11uqiyn{grid-template-columns:repeat(2,minmax(0,1fr));gap:1rem;margin-bottom:1rem;display:grid}@media (width<=1024px){.results-grid.svelte-11uqiyn{grid-template-columns:1fr}}.chart-shell.svelte-11uqiyn{height:260px}.bookmark-note.svelte-11uqiyn{color:var(--color-muted);margin-top:1rem}.unit-toggle.svelte-11uqiyn{gap:.5rem;margin-bottom:.75rem;display:flex}.unit-btn.svelte-11uqiyn{border-radius:var(--radius-sm);border:1px solid var(--color-border);background:var(--color-surface-2);color:var(--color-muted);cursor:pointer;flex:1;padding:.45rem .75rem;font-size:.85rem;font-weight:600;transition:all .15s}.unit-btn.active.svelte-11uqiyn{background:var(--color-accent);border-color:var(--color-accent);color:var(--color-text)}.unit-btn.svelte-11uqiyn:focus-visible{outline:2px solid var(--color-accent);outline-offset:3px}.ft-in-row.svelte-11uqiyn{align-items:center;gap:.4rem;display:flex}.macro-header.svelte-11uqiyn{margin-bottom:.75rem}.macro-subtitle.svelte-11uqiyn{color:var(--color-muted);margin-top:.25rem;font-size:.85rem}.macro-list.svelte-11uqiyn{flex-direction:column;gap:.5rem;margin:0;padding:0;list-style:none;display:flex}.macro-list.svelte-11uqiyn li:where(.svelte-11uqiyn){border-bottom:1px solid var(--color-border);justify-content:space-between;align-items:center;padding:.5rem 0;display:flex}.macro-list.svelte-11uqiyn li:where(.svelte-11uqiyn):last-child{border-bottom:none}.macro-name.svelte-11uqiyn{color:var(--color-text);flex:1;font-weight:500}.macro-values.svelte-11uqiyn{color:var(--color-accent);text-align:right;min-width:60px;margin-right:.5rem;font-weight:600}.macro-kcal.svelte-11uqiyn{color:var(--color-muted);text-align:right;min-width:75px;font-size:.85rem}.ft-in-row.svelte-11uqiyn input:where(.svelte-11uqiyn){width:3.5rem}@media (width<=640px){.ft-in-row.svelte-11uqiyn{gap:.3rem}.ft-in-row.svelte-11uqiyn input:where(.svelte-11uqiyn){width:3rem}}.unit-label.svelte-11uqiyn{color:var(--color-muted);font-size:.85rem}
